Enhancing Core Operations and Production Efficiency
Modern Enterprise Resource Planning (ERP) systems are central to optimizing core business operations and production processes. These systems provide a unified view of an organization’s resources, enabling more precise management in areas like manufacturing scheduling, inventory control, and quality assurance. By integrating data from various departments, ERP solutions facilitate real-time insights, allowing businesses to identify bottlenecks, reduce waste, and improve overall efficiency. The ability to monitor production lines, manage raw materials, and track finished goods from a single platform significantly streamlines workflows and supports agile decision-making, which is crucial for maintaining competitiveness in a rapidly evolving industry landscape.

ERP systems vary significantly in their capabilities, target industries, and associated costs. The total cost of an ERP system typically includes software licenses or subscriptions, implementation services, customization, training, and ongoing maintenance or support. Factors such as the size of the enterprise, the complexity of its operations, the number of users, and the required level of integration with existing systems all influence the overall investment. Cloud-based solutions often involve subscription models (SaaS), which spread costs over time and reduce upfront capital expenditure, while on-premise systems may require substantial initial hardware and licensing investments.
